(Q16995321)

English

Hi-Tech Automotive

car builder and automotive design house in South Africa

Statements

0 references

Map

33°55'16.32"S, 25°21'41.15"E
0 references

Identifiers

0 references
 
edit
edit
    edit
      edit
        edit
          edit
            edit
              edit
                edit